#ifndef INTERRUPT_H
#define INTERRUPT_H
#include <stdint.h>
#define SVC_MODE 0b10011
#define IRQ_MODE 0b10010
struct context {
uint32_t cpsr;
uint32_t r[16]; // fp=r11 ip=r12 sp=r13 lr=r14 pc=r15
};
extern uint32_t arm_intr_vector;
void trap_enter(struct context *tf, uint32_t cpsr);
void set_vector_base_addr(uint32_t *);
enum procstate { UNUSED, RUNNABLE };
struct proc {
enum procstate state; // Process state
int pid; // Process ID
struct proc *parent;
struct context context;
char name[16]; // Process name (debugging)
uint32_t pgd; // page descriptor
};
#define NPROC 64 // maximum support 64 processes
void proc_init(void);
void proc_schd(void);
void trap_return(struct context*, struct context* p_context_schd);
void schd(struct context* p_context_schd);
typedef struct ARM_INTR_REG {
volatile uint32_t cpu_pending;
volatile uint32_t gpu_pending[2];
volatile uint32_t fiq_ctl;
volatile uint32_t gpu_enable[2];
volatile uint32_t cpu_enable;
volatile uint32_t gpu_disable[2];
volatile uint32_t cpu_disable;
} ARM_INTR_REG;
#define ARM_INTR_REG_BASE 0x2000b200
extern uint32_t ticks;
extern uint32_t ticks_interval;
// Bank 0
#define ARM_TIMER 0
#define ARM_MAILBOX 1
#define ARM_DOORBELL_0 2
#define ARM_DOORBELL_1 3
#define VPU0_HALTED 4
#define VPU1_HALTED 5
#define ILLEGAL_TYPE0 6
#define ILLEGAL_TYPE1 7
// Bank 1
//#define TIMER0 0
#define TIMER1 1
#define TIMER2 2
//#define TIMER3 3
// first and third timer comparators are used by the GPU https://forums.raspberrypi.com/viewtopic.php?t=234418
#define CODEC0 4
#define CODEC1 5
#define CODEC2 6
#define VC_JPEG 7
#define ISP 8
#define VC_USB 9
#define VC_3D 10
#define TRANSPOSER 11
#define MULTICORESYNC0 12
#define MULTICORESYNC1 13
#define MULTICORESYNC2 14
#define MULTICORESYNC3 15
#define DMA0 16
#define DMA1 17
#define VC_DMA2 18
#define VC_DMA3 19
#define DMA4 20
#define DMA5 21
#define DMA6 22
#define DMA7 23
#define DMA8 24
#define DMA9 25
#define DMA10 26
#define DMA11 27
#define DMAALL 28
#define AUX 29
#define ARM 30
#define VPUDMA 31
// Bank 2
#define HOSTPORT 0
#define VIDEOSCALER 1
#define CCP2TX 2
#define SDC 3
#define DSI0 4
#define AVE 5
#define CAM0 6
#define CAM1 7
#define HDMI0 8
#define HDMI1 9
#define PIXELVALVE1 10
#define I2CSPISLV 11
#define DSI1 12
#define PWA0 13
#define PWA1 14
#define CPR 15
#define SMI 16
#define GPIO0 17
#define GPIO1 18
#define GPIO2 19
#define GPIO3 20
#define VC_I2C 21
#define VC_SPI 22
#define VC_I2SPCM 23
#define VC_SDIO 24
#define VC_UART 25
#define SLIMBUS 26
#define VEC 27
#define CPG 28
#define RNG 29
#define VC_ARASANSDIO 30
#define AVSPMON 31
void enable_irq(int bank, int bit);
void proc_fork(void);
extern struct proc procs[];
extern struct proc *curproc;
extern struct context context_schd;
#endif
